distrustfully

/dɪstrʌstfʊli/ adverb · British & US
Valid in UKValid in US
Share WhatsApp

What does distrustfully mean?

adverb

Having or showing a lack of trust; distrustfully is used to describe something that is done with a lack of trust or suspicion.

Example

"She looked at him distrustfully, wondering if he was telling the truth."
